The Paragon-X GUI shows a number of green/red indicators, which I believe are referred to as 'soft LEDs'. What do these actually mean in the Connected Slave and Connected Master panels?
The meaning of the LEDs in these panels varies according to whether the test is running in multicast or unicast mode:
Multicast:
Grey | P-X master was receiving Del_Req messages from the Slave but the P-X master is now inactive |
---|---|
Green | P-X master is receiving Del_Req messages from the Slave |
Red | P-X master was receiving Del_Req messages from the Slave but is no longer receiving them |
Unicast Auto:
Grey | P-X master had granted the Slave unicast messaging but the P-X master is now inactive |
---|---|
Green | P-X master has granted the Slave unicast messaging |
Red | P-X master had granted the Slave unicast messaging but this has expired or the slave cancelled it |
Unicast Forced:
Grey | Slave not enabled in configuration, or P-X master is inactive |
---|---|
Green | P-X master is sending Announce/Sync messages to the slave |
Red | (Not used) |
